How is a Hanukkah menorah different from a regular one?

(A Hanukkah menorah) has eight branches plus the one for the servant candle or lamp of oil that’s used to light the other ones. The most famous menorah, of course, is the seven-branch menorah and that comes straight from Bible, where Moses is commanded to have one crafted to put into the Temple.
